What is Double Glazing?
Before diving into repairs, it's important to understand what Double Glazing Specialists glazing is. Double glazing includes 2 panes of glass separated by a spacer bar and sealed around the edges. This design develops an insulating barrier, substantially improving energy efficiency compared to single-pane windows.

While double glazing is reliable, it is not immune to issues. House owners may experience various problems that require repair. Here are some typical issues:
Seal Failure: The seals around the glass can break down with time, causing moisture going into the air gap in between the panes. This leads to fogging or condensation.
Cracks and Chips: Glass can sustain physical damage from effects, weather occasions, or accidental contact.
Frame Damage: Wooden frames can rot, while aluminum or PVCu frames may warp or suffer rust.
Poor Installation: Improper setup can lead to air leaks and inadequate thermal performance.
Operational Issues: Problems with the functioning of window mechanisms, such as locks or hinges, can avoid proper opening and closing.
Comprehending Seal Failure
Seal failure is among the most common problems dealt with by double glazing owners. It occurs when the seals around the glass panes break down, allowing moisture to go into. This can cause undesirable condensation and make it hard to translucent the windows.

FAQs About Double Glazing RepairsQ1: How long do double-glazed windows last?
A1: With correct upkeep, double-glazed windows can last anywhere from 15 to 25 years.
Q2: How can I inform if my double glazing needs repair?
A2: Signs consist of noticeable Condensation In Windows in between panes, drafts, problem opening or closing windows, and decreased exposure due to damage.
Q3: Can I repair double glazing myself?
A3: Minor concerns might be manageable, however most repairs are best left to specialists due to threats and the complexity included.
Q4: What are the expenses connected with double glazing repair?
A4: Costs differ based upon the type of damage and repair needed. Seal replacement might cost around ₤ 100-₤ 250, while glass replacement could vary from ₤ 200-₤ 600.
Q5: How can I avoid problems with my double glazing?
A5: Regular upkeep, including cleansing and inspecting seals, will prolong the life-span of your double-glazed windows.
